Certificate Students

North Park Theological Seminary offers 11 certificates in a variety of ministry areas. Most can be completed over the course of a few semesters. Individuals who complete NPTS certificates fall into a variety of categories including:

  • Women and men serving in vocational ministry who desire to enhance their skills or knowledge
  • Men and women desiring to gain more knowledge in general theology or a specific theological topic
  • Individuals taking courses to fulfill Covenant credentialing requirements
  • Students wishing to take courses at NPTS regional sites

Cohort Certificate Programs

The Seminary also offers two unique, cohort certificate programs, in Urban Ministry and Spiritual Direction. Each is designed to be completed over the course of two-and-a-half years. Specific application information can be found on these certificate description pages.

Prerequisite: The prerequisite for entrance to graduate studies at North Park Theological Seminary, in any degree or non-degree program, is a bachelor's degree (or its academic equivalent) from an accredited college or university, with a GPA of at least 2.5.

Application Process

  1. Complete the appropriate application form and write an autobiographical essay as directed on the application form
  2. Send in your application and essay, along with a $25 non-refundable application fee
  3. Ask one individual to complete the pastoral reference and return it directly to the Seminary Admissions Office
  4. Request your official bachelor's degree transcripts, and transcripts from any other colleges and institutions you have have attended
  5. Complete a FAFSA if you wish to be considered for aid
  6. Consult our list of frequently asked questions for more information

Deadlines

  • Applications are considered as they are received, and on a space-available basis after priority deadlines have passed. If space is unavailable, students will be considered for admittance for subsequent semesters.
